I have never seen a type album for Newfoundland coins, but there are
for Canadian coins. In my Candian type set I do put Newfounland coins
into the holes when possible.

Because I like Newfies too

I have only seen used albums for Canadian type coins. They can be found
in very good condition. Just keep watching ebay, one wil pop up.

The easiest to find are Whitman albums, then Dansco.

To build a type set you would just need one of each type. Nice that you can avoid the expensive and rare coins when there is a $10k coin in the mix.

Turns out there is an album for Newfie type set. Whitman used to make one but it may be out of print so you would need to find an older / used one, likely on ebay.
